Original Description
Gino Carlo Sensani's Portrait of Mrs. Christine Mavrogordato exudes an air of refined elegance, capturing the subject with a striking balance of realism and expressive flair. Painted during the early 20th century, Sensani's work reflects influences from post-impressionism and the bold stylizations of the Art Deco movement, blending rich textures with a sophisticated color palette. Mrs. Mavrogordato’s poised demeanor, accentuated by meticulous detailing in her attire and surroundings, suggests both individuality and timeless grace. While Sensani remains less widely known than some contemporaries, this portrait exemplifies his skill in conveying personality through nuanced brushwork and composition, occupying a distinctive place in early modern portraiture—bridging classical techniques and modernist sensibilities. The painting invites contemplation, its subtle interplay of light and shadow drawing viewers into its intimate narrative.
